孫成豪+王婉貞+周潤
摘 要:航班計(jì)劃是一個(gè)實(shí)時(shí)優(yōu)化問題。諸多不確定因素會(huì)造成正常航班的擾動(dòng),包括航空器故障,惡劣天氣,交通管制等。本文的目的是通過構(gòu)建數(shù)學(xué)模型來得出不正常航班飛機(jī)恢復(fù)的優(yōu)化方案。本文將航班的延誤時(shí)間處理為隨機(jī)變量,總延誤時(shí)間作為優(yōu)化目標(biāo),在可用的資源和航空公司估計(jì)成本的機(jī)會(huì)約束條件下,構(gòu)建了一個(gè)隨機(jī)機(jī)會(huì)約束規(guī)劃模型。
關(guān)鍵詞:航空公司運(yùn)營;不正常航班;飛機(jī)恢復(fù);機(jī)會(huì)約束規(guī)劃;遺傳算法
DOI:10.16640/j.cnki.37-1222/t.2017.12.238
0 引言
由于航空業(yè)的特點(diǎn)和競爭的需要,航空公司的航班運(yùn)行控制對(duì)運(yùn)籌學(xué)的許多分支理論和方法,特別是最優(yōu)化技術(shù)有著非常迫切的需求。
在國外,文獻(xiàn)[1]中,Yu提出了針對(duì)航空公司不正常航班調(diào)度問題的擾動(dòng)管理策略,就航空公司常規(guī)和非常規(guī)航班調(diào)度問題進(jìn)行了建模優(yōu)化。文獻(xiàn)[2]找到快速有效的算法和軟件處理航班調(diào)度問題。Teodorobic ,Stojkovicd等人[3]為了使取消航班數(shù)量和旅客總延誤時(shí)間最小,提出了一種基于Lexicographic動(dòng)態(tài)規(guī)劃模型。在我國,趙秀麗[4]把航班延誤時(shí)間看作為常量,分別對(duì)不正常航班的取消航班問題、飛機(jī)路線恢復(fù)問題、機(jī)組恢復(fù)問題、一體化航班計(jì)劃恢復(fù)問題進(jìn)行了研究。文獻(xiàn)[5]中就機(jī)組延誤問題,建立了基于概率的魯棒性機(jī)組配對(duì)問題和飛機(jī)排班問題的隨機(jī)模型。本文針對(duì)不正常航班下的飛機(jī)恢復(fù)問題研究建立相應(yīng)的優(yōu)化模型及算法。后續(xù)內(nèi)容安排如下:第2章是預(yù)備知識(shí);第3章是問題描述和基本建模方法;模型及算法在第4章;全文的總結(jié)和展望放在了第5章。
1 隨機(jī)機(jī)會(huì)約束規(guī)劃
定義2.1[6]假設(shè)x是一個(gè)決策向量,ξ是一個(gè)隨機(jī)向量,是目標(biāo)函數(shù),(j=1,2,…,p)是沒有給出確定的可行集的隨機(jī)約束函數(shù)。機(jī)會(huì)約束可以表示為如下的形式:
2 問題描述與基本方法
當(dāng)惡劣天氣或機(jī)械故障引起航班延誤時(shí),由于惡劣天氣持續(xù)時(shí)間和故障機(jī)械修復(fù)時(shí)間都是不確定的,從而航班延誤時(shí)間是不確定的。本文將總延誤時(shí)間作為優(yōu)化目標(biāo),而公司成本預(yù)算作為約束條件,建立問題的模型及算法。Argüello [7]提出了時(shí)間帶近似模型相關(guān)理論,本文采用時(shí)空網(wǎng)絡(luò)結(jié)構(gòu)來調(diào)整航班安排。
3 飛機(jī)恢復(fù)問題的機(jī)會(huì)約束規(guī)劃模型與算法
約束二:飛行的覆蓋范圍。每個(gè)航班都只有飛行或取消兩種狀態(tài),因此,每個(gè)航班k對(duì)應(yīng)的飛行和取消狀態(tài)和為1。例如,航班34有兩種可選飛行航線,一個(gè)取消狀態(tài),每個(gè)航班僅執(zhí)行一次,可得以下公式:
同理,所有航班k均可表達(dá)為上述形式。
約束三:轉(zhuǎn)送結(jié)點(diǎn)飛機(jī)流。結(jié)點(diǎn)中的飛機(jī)數(shù)量=在該結(jié)點(diǎn)起飛飛機(jī)數(shù)量-在該結(jié)點(diǎn)降落飛機(jī)數(shù)量+由該結(jié)點(diǎn)轉(zhuǎn)移到同一城市沉落結(jié)點(diǎn)的飛機(jī)數(shù)量。
約束四:沉落結(jié)點(diǎn)飛機(jī)流。沉落結(jié)點(diǎn)需要的飛機(jī)數(shù)量=在該沉落結(jié)點(diǎn)降落的結(jié)束航班的飛機(jī)數(shù)量+從同一城市其他結(jié)點(diǎn)轉(zhuǎn)移來過夜的飛機(jī)數(shù)量。
每個(gè)沉落結(jié)點(diǎn)都有相對(duì)應(yīng)的約束條件:
由此得到模型: